- Hook
- Standard Dry Fly Hook (e.g., TMC 100, sizes 10-14)
- Thread
- Brown or Olive 8/0
- Tail
- Two individual strands of dark mottled hackle (or Coq de Leon), tied to split and splay apart.
- Body
- Pearl/Holographic Tinsel (Purple/Blue iridescence)
- Ribbing
- Gold wire (Fine)
- Wing
- Mottled Partridge or Hen Wing (Upright and divided)
- Hackle
- Sparse dark brown/grey mottled cock hackle, tied as a collar.
- Tail
- Secure the thread base. Select two perfectly matched, long, stiff hackle fibers. Tie them in at the bend, and then use a figure-eight wrap between the two strands to force them apart into a 'V' shape. They must be stiff enough to support the fly on the water's surface.
- Body
- Tie in the gold wire and tinsel. Wrap the tinsel up the shank to form a smooth body. Counter-wrap the gold wire over the tinsel to secure it and add durability.
- Wing
- Prepare the partridge or hen wing section. Tie it in using a figure-eight wrap to create a realistic, divided, upright wing.
- Hackle
- Select a hackle with fibers of the correct length (about 1.5 times the hook gap). Tie it in just behind the wing. Wrap 3-4 turns of hackle, ensuring the fibers are distributed evenly as a collar *above and to the sides* of the hook. Crucially, ensure no fibers point directly downward.
- Finish
- Build a small thread head, whip finish, and apply head cement.
